Guest szekely Posted January 6, 2014 Report Posted January 6, 2014 (edited) i have the Romanian model G510 - 0100 vodafone, had the same problem. the only way i found was this method. you have to install a custom rom stock based B194-199 rom with a custom recovery (twrp recomended), backup your Imei, reset the imei to nul, install the B170 update, then root and restore imei back. you will be able to update to b193 from settings - update. i tried it twice, worked any time, but don't forget to backup your imei . i read in the German forum that only the b173 -0200 update works, but without NFC. This is the only oficial firmware from Huawei page, shame... no 0100 update.. Edited January 6, 2014 by szekely
Guest wbrambley Posted January 6, 2014 Report Posted January 6, 2014 it seems B193 was an OTA update from your provider. i cant find it either. That being said, have you tried going into fastboot mode and flashing recovery from your pc? when disconected from pc, hold volume down buton and press power until screen lights up. Keep holding volume down a litttle longer, screen should stop on huawei logo. connect pc and start command prompt in your platform tools folder (for me its "C:\Program Files (x86)\Android\android-sdk\platform-tools") Type in "fastboot devices",hit enter and you HOPEFULLY get something like this; C:\Users\William>fastboot devices a48039cd fastboot If you do that is good news. Type in "fastboot flash recovery c:\folder\whatever\yourcustomrecovery.img" and hit enter. you should be then able to boot into recovery. hope this helps.
